Since the failure event in our analysis is the death of the individual, the baseline hazard of our model h0(t) is age, measured as time since the 50th birthday. It is assumed to follow a Gompertz distribution, defined as

where ? and ?0 are ancillary parameters that control the shape of the baseline hazard. The Gompertz distribution, proposed by Benjamin Gompertz in 1825, has been widely used by demographers to model human mortality data. The exponentially increasing hazard of the Gompertz distribution is a useful approximation for ages between 30 and 95. For younger ages, mortality tends to differ from the exponential curve due to infant and accident mortality. For advanced ages, the increase in the risk of death tends to decelerate so that the Gompertz model overestimates mortality at these ages (Thatcher, Kannisto, and Vaupel 1998). I assume that the impact of this deceleration on my results is negligible because the number of married people over age 95 is extremely low.
